Mauricio Pochettino tips Brad Friedel for management

Tottenham Hotspur boss Mauricio Pochettino believes that Brad Friedel could return to the Premier League as a manager.

Tottenham Hotspur head coach Mauricio Pochettino has claimed that Brad Friedel could build a successful career in management after he announced his retirement.

The veteran goalkeeper confirmed on Thursday that he will return to the US to become a pundit when his Spurs contract expires at the end of the season, but Pochettino believes that the 43-year-old could return to the Premier League.

"The announcement is a very special moment for him. It's a real pleasure to work with him and to know him because he's a top man, a top professional and it was fantastic to spend time with him this season," the Argentine told reporters.

"Why not [return as a manager]? Brad is a very clever person and with his natural energy and his leadership he can easily manage a team in the Premier League – only if he wants to, and wants to take that way in his future.

"But if he's ready and he's experienced - and he's learned a lot about football in all of his career - I think it's possible in the next few seasons he can manage."

Friedel will become the oldest player to have appeared in the Premier League if he plays in either of Tottenham's final two games.
